Situated near Pasabag Monks Valley between Avanos and Goreme, Zelve Valley is one of Cappadocia’s most renowned outdoor museum sites. As a UNESCO World Heritage Site, it offers visitors the chance to admire the sharp, pointed fairy chimneys.
Cavusin - The next stop on the tour is Çavusin, an old Greek village located about 4 kilometers from Göreme. The old village is mostly abandoned due to rock falls. Visitors can explore the Church of John the Baptist, which likely dates back to the 5th century and features paintings from the 6th, 7th, and 8th centuries. Bezirhane Culture, Arts and Ceramics Center - Since the Hittite era in 2000 BC, people have sourced red clays (terra rosa) from the Kızılırmak River, Turkey’s longest river, and white clays (kaolin) from volcanic hills. These clays were used in daily life, shaped by hand on spinning wheels.

Devrent Valley - The ruins at Devrent are spread across three valleys, featuring several pointed fairy chimneys with large stems.
Urgup - The “fairy chimneys” with caps, primarily found near Ürgüp, have a conical body topped with a boulder. The cone is made of tufa and volcanic ash, while the cap consists of a harder, more resistant rock like lahar or ignimbrite. These iconic fairy chimneys, known as holy spirit chimneys, symbolize Ürgüp. They are often referred to as the mother, father, and son chimneys. After the tour, you will be dropped off at your hotel.

Ihlara Valley - Located 52 km from the Underground City, Ihlara Canyon is reached after approximately 45 minutes. Formed by volcanic activity from Mt. Hasan, the valley was further eroded by the Melendiz River over millions of years, resulting in an 80-meter-deep canyon. The entire valley stretches 14 km. Historically, Christians inhabited various parts of the valley, carving and painting churches. Pigeons have always been significant to the people of Cappadocia, as their eggs and droppings were used for various purposes. Locals carved houses for them into the valley slopes, and you will understand why they are called “houses” when you see them.
